And you will indeed require risers, with the reason for that being the tray can only clear 1-5/8" lips. But you can get it up to 3-1/8" higher than that by using the Height Adjustment Kit for MORryde RV Cargo Sliding Trays # MR34VR.

Finding the correct replacement slide-out seal for your 2013 Coachmen Freedom Express 192 RBS will require removing the existing seal to measure its dimensions and find the shape. This information is necessary to match up a replacement using the list from the link below. For example, the Rubber Top Lip Wiper Seal for RV Slide Out part # SR23VR measures 2-1/2" wide and fits a 1/4" thick pinch-weld flange.
Unfortunately, we aren't able to confirm a slide out seal with just the make and model. view full answer...

It's hard to say without any photos of your current plugs/connectors. Some slide-in campers like Lance use a proprietary plug that we wouldn't have. Your truck's 7 way is likely a standard one that has flat blades. You could use an extension like Hopkins 7-Way RV Style Connector with Molded Cable - Trailer End - 8' Long - RV Standard # H20046 and run the bare wires to your slide-in camper and rewire it to the camper's plug. view full answer...
